Repossessed Cars for Sale and Why Car Buyers Want Them

Serious car buyers find repossessed cars for sale as the best choice when it comes to second hand vehicles. The reason for this is because, more often than not, these cars are in great shape upon purchase as compared to other pre-owned cars that are being sold elsewhere. Some repossessed cars are flashy enough to be mistaken as new.

For a lot of people, buying a car is a major decision simply because it can be very costly. Those who have a tight budget usually settle for second hand vehicles mainly for practical reasons. Moreover, it is also easier on the pocket. Repossessed cars are great choice for those who want to purchase a nice car at a very low price. Another advantage is that most repossessed cars had never been involved in serious accidents.

Buyers can also be reassured that these cars are working well since they had only been repossessed from the owners and not acquired from repair shops or second hand car auctions. Just to be sure, buyers should make it a point to take their time in checking the engine and other features of the car.

Repossessed cars that are on sale were previously owned by individuals who had problems settling their monthly payments. Thus, the lending company or their bank "repossessed" the car. Repossessed cars are put on auction and offered to the public at a price they can easily afford.

There are also some repossessed cars that had been impounded by the local authorities secondary to law violations. In some instances, the car had been seized by law enforcers because it was used for illegal operations.

Repossessed cars being put on sale are considered best buys because their price range is reasonable enough especially for those who are in dire need of a car but have a limited budget. Since a lot of these cars still look new, the chances of finding a dream car is not impossible at all. The most exciting part is that it can cost much less than its actual value. A good 90% off the car's original price is an offer any serious buyer could never resist.

If you are wondering where to find repossessed cars on sale, you can check out the ads in your local newspaper. You can also make inquiries in lending companies or banks and even local police offices as to when they are having an auction for repossessed cars. If your community has a bulletin board for public announcements, you can also take the time to check it out.
